Kenya has a moderate cost of living, varying by location. Groceries and local food are affordable. Rent is higher in Nairobi and Mombasa, but lower in smaller towns. Utilities and internet are moderately priced but can be inconsistent. Eating out is inexpensive at local restaurants. Health care is affordable, though private hospitals charge more. Overall, Kenya offers a manageable cost of living with affordable basics and slightly higher urban expenses.
